安卓恶意软件持续威胁全球数百万用户的安全。尽管已有诸多基于机器学习的检测方法,但其对大规模标注数据的依赖使其在面对新兴、此前未见的恶意软件家族时效果受限,因缺乏相关标注数据。为此,我们提出一种新型零样本学习框架,融合变分图自编码器(VGAE)与孪生神经网络(SNN),无需特定恶意软件家族的先验样本即可识别恶意软件。该方法利用安卓应用的图结构表示,能够捕捉良性与恶意软件之间的细微结构差异,即使在无新威胁标注数据的情况下亦可有效检测。实验结果表明,该方法在零日恶意软件检测上优于现有最优的MaMaDroid。模型对未知恶意软件家族的准确率达96.24%,召回率为95.20%,展现出对不断演化的安卓威胁的强大鲁棒性。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

The persistent threat of Android malware presents a serious challenge to the security of millions of users globally. While many machine learning-based methods have been developed to detect these threats, their reliance on large labeled datasets limits their effectiveness against emerging, previously unseen malware families, for which labeled data is scarce or nonexistent. To address this challenge, we introduce a novel zero-shot learning framework that combines Variational Graph Auto-Encoders (VGAE) with Siamese Neural Networks (SNN) to identify malware without needing prior examples of specific malware families. Our approach leverages graph-based representations of Android applications, enabling the model to detect subtle structural differences between benign and malicious software, even in the absence of labeled data for new threats. Experimental results show that our method outperforms the state-of-the-art MaMaDroid, especially in zero-day malware detection. Our model achieves 96.24% accuracy and 95.20% recall for unknown malware families, highlighting its robustness against evolving Android threats.
